Stadium
The , known for sponsorship reasons as Cooper Associates , is a cricket ground in , . It is the home of Somerset County Cricket Club, who have played there since 1882. is situated 1½ miles southwest of Maidenbrook Meadow.

Village
is a village and civil parish in , England, situated 2 miles north east of . The parish includes the hamlets of Monkton Heathfield, Bathpool, and Burlinch and the western parts of Coombe and Walford, and had a population of 2,787 at the 2011 census.
